Transaction 07c8b3237ef612b05c4c288fb71fc449615cdd424d9cc3b79b6b3fb0a5221a5f

6 Input
1 Outputs
  • 07c8b3237ef612b05c4c288fb71fc449615cdd424d9cc3b79b6b3fb0a5221a5f:0
  • value  8894023
    address  3572cX29E4tkL23bgz1HVG27mff6NnCsbD